Overview

The 1-bedroom Kelpies Cottage offers swift access to various city sites, such as Gallery Sia Tri, situated nearly a 5-minute ride away. This property features opportunities for canoeing, hiking, and horse riding in the area, 18 minutes' stroll from 7stanes.

Location

Galloway is a 15-minute drive away.

The nearest bus stop is Post Office, a short way from the 1-bathroom villa.

Rooms

The inner design comes with a sofa, as well as a flat-screen TV with satellite channels. Bathroom facilities also include a separate toilet, a bath, and a shower. Towels are included for added comfort.

Eat & Drink

A full kitchen, along with a dining place, are available for dining. You can also make use of an electric kettle, a refrigerator, and an oven to prepare your own meal.
